What You’ll Do

As a Senior Peer Counselor, you’ll offer compassionate, confidential support to other older adults (55+) who may be facing:

  • Isolation or loneliness
  • Grief and loss
  • Health challenges
  • Life transitions and emotional distress

Volunteers provide either:

  • One-on-one support (in person or by phone)
  • Co-facilitate a weekly support group (with additional training & support)

You’ll meet with clients weekly for 12 weeks, offering presence and empathy—not advice or problem-solving. Just your real, caring self.


 What You’ll Learn

Our 35-hour training program (Jan–May 2026) includes:

  • Communication & listening skills
  • Grief and loss
  • Boundaries and ethics
  • Aging and mental health
  • Supportive tools and resources

Training is held in Santa Rosa and via Zoom.


 Commitment & Support

  • 1-year commitment after training
  • Meet with one client per week (1 hour/week)
  • Attend twice-monthly supervision (1st & 3rd Mondays, 10am–12pm)
  • Optional group facilitation with mentorship & support
